If you do the labor yourself then it will be about $500 or so, including rebuilt stock IRS tranny. You can get alot of the parts from www2.cip1.com in Canada. If someone else does the labor $$$$$
. The more you can do the cheaper it will be on labor. Ideally you should give the person doing the work just the pan, weld-in mounts, trailing arms, torsion bars, torsion end caps,and spring plates. The hardest part of the swap is alining the trailing arms for propper camber and toe in before welding everything up.
I have the entire stock IRS set-up on the floor in my shop right now. I went the late model 944 ali set-up with 944 torsion bars, end caps, two piece spring plates, axles, CVs, trailing arms, and turbo brakes.
